If he wanted to rule it out, he would have done it there and then.

BoxeR made his manofoneway ID under his girlfriend's name so that he could practise secretly. He'd already decided to join even before his BW contract ran out and waited an entire GSL before stepping into the arena because the contract overlapped with the qualifiers.

Having read the interview you posted, I think the chances of him switching are even higher.

"Q: What are your plans now?
A: I'm not entirely sure yet. I want to continue doing shows like "Staying up with Shin-Ae". I'm not ruling out coaching or playing StarCraft 2 entirely - there are other possibilities as well. But currently, I don't really have any concrete plans, and I'll be spending the next few months contemplating and organizing my thoughts."
